Case Style:

Anthony Lee Carl and Candace Leigh Cart v. Automax Norman, L.L.C. and Nyundai Motor America

Case Number: CJ-2020-598

Judge: Thad Balkman

Court: In the District Court in and for Cleveland County, Oklahoma

Defendant's Attorney: John M. Bunting. Phoebe B. Mitchell, Derrick Teague and Michael D. Carter

Description: Norman, Oklahoma personal injury car wreck lawyer represented Plaintiff, who sued Defendant on an negligence theory claiming to have suffered more than $10,000 in damages and/or injuries as a direct result of the death of Braden Elliot Carl. The action was based on the Oklahoma Survivor Statutes, 12 O.S. 1052, and the Oklahoma Wrongful Death Statute, 12 O.S. 1053.

Brand Carl owned a 2013 Hyundai Veloster with which he had numerous problems. It was worked on 13 times with Automax having possession and control over the vehicle for 162 days. Automax worked on the exhaust system on August 7, 2018. He died from carbon dioxide poisoning on October 22, 2018, as a direct result of an exhaust system leak.

Outcome: Settled for an undisclosed dum and dismissed with prejudice as to AutoMax.
